The Power of Collaboration in Driving Social Media Engagement

MehfilBy MehfilNovember 20, 20235 Mins Read

With competition increasing on social media, there is a need for businesses to think of unique ways to promote their brands. One of the most effective ways is through collaboration. By working with other brands and influencers, you can have a comprehensive social media promotion strategy to drive engagement.

However, if it’s your first time collaborating with other brands or influencers, it can feel like navigating unchartered waters. This article will guide you on leveraging relationships with other brands to grow engagement on your social media account.

What is social media collaboration?

This is a strategic partnership between individuals, brands, or businesses, where you agree to co-create content and leverage each other’s audiences. The partnership can be between influencers, non-profit organizations, businesses, brands, etc. The collaboration can be in different forms, such as:

  • Guest posts
  • Joint campaigns
  • Co-hosted events
  • Giveaways

Benefits of social media collaborations

Here are some good reasons why businesses should collaborate.

Reach new audiences

When two brands join forces, they can create a new world where you can reach each other’s customers. This will result in increased visibility in the digital space. 

Vote of confidence

When a popular brand or influencer endorses your product, this is seen as a vote of confidence in the brand. This can build the trust and credibility for your brand.

More engagement on your posts

When you work with an influencer, you are likely to see an increase in likes, shares, and comments for your posts. You will also see increased followers, especially when collaborating with a social media promotion service.

A cost-effective marketing strategy

Advertising on mainstream media can be expensive. On the other hand, collaborating with a brand is a cost-effective way of making your brand known.

Tips for successful social media collaborations

To ensure that your collaboration works and brings more traffic, here are tips to follow:

Choose the collaboration type

You must determine your goal and the kind of collaboration to choose.  Some of the questions to ask yourself are:

  • Is it a temporary collaboration or a  permanent partnership? 
  •  What are your expectations, and what do you expect to give in return?
  • What is the compensation for both parties?
  • If any contention creation is needed, who will hold the intellectual rights?
  • What contingency plans should be there if the relationship doesn’t work?

Choose a collaborator

After determining the kind of collaboration you need, the next step is to choose a partner. This is an important step as you want to find one whose values align with your goals. Some of the issues to consider are:

  • Do you share audiences, or do they complement one another?
  • What value will you be getting from the candidate?
  • Does the candidate have a solid reputation? Are you convinced of their track record online and offline?

Choose a candidate whose goals align with yours.

Have open communication

For collaboration to succeed, there is a need for honest and open communication. Therefore, you should have an agreement laid out in writing. Ensure you agree on how often you will keep in touch to check the progress.

Agree on a shared goal

Goals are important for any social media marketing, and this includes collaboration. Before creating content, you should agree on a goal that can be tracked and measured. 

The goal could be driving traffic to a page, increasing conversion, and more. Avoid goals that can’t be quantified, such as getting more followers. It can be hard to measure the success that the increased followers bring.

Develop a framework for collaboration

Ensure that you set clear expectations, firm deadlines, and explicit objectives. The framework should be direct and detailed and should set the terms of engagement such as:

  • Period of partnership
  • Aim of the collaboration
  • How costs are to be shared
  • Milestones to gauge success
  • A guide on the style of posts
  • Role of each party

Agree on a social media style

People will associate your brand with a certain tone. You should ensure that even in your collaboration, the tone is maintained. Therefore, before creating content, meet and share your style with your collaborator. But remember that a good collaboration should take into account the interests of both brands. So, where necessary, you should be ready to make adjustments.

Disclose on partnership

When a post has been created in collaboration with other brands, you should always disclose that. This is not only required legally in most jurisdictions, but it will also help you gain the trust of your collaborator and audience. Therefore, ensure that all sponsored posts are well-labeled.

Collaboration with influencers can bring more business.

Social media collaborations are based on the premise that two heads are better than one. With a good collaborator, it’s possible to increase engagement and conversion on your social media account. By following the above tips, you can have an effective collaboration that will grow your social media accounts.
